I am creating a simple message system. At first I used POST to receive new alerts. In jQuery I had:
$.post('/a/alerts', 'stamp=' + STAMP, function(result)
{
});
And in PHP I used $_POST['stamp']. Even from localhost I got 90-100 ms for every request like this. I simply changed:
$.get('/a/alerts?stamp=' + STAMP, function(result)
{
});
and in PHP switched to $_GET['stamp']. So a little less than 1 minute of changes. Now every request takes 30-40 ms.
So GET can be twice as fast as POST. Of course not always but for small amounts of data I get same results all the time.
GET is slightly faster because the values are sent in the header unlike the POST the values are sent in the request body, in the format that the content type specifies.
Usually the content type is application/x-www-form-urlencoded, so the request body uses the same format as the query string:
parameter=value&also=another When you use a file upload in the form, you use the multipart/form-data encoding instead, which has a different format. It's more complicated.
